In this rapidly evolving technological landscape, terms like Machine Learning (ML) and Artificial Intelligence (AI) have become increasingly common. But what do they actually mean? In this article, we will demystify the world of ML AI and provide a clear understanding of the basics of these exciting fields.
What is Machine Learning?
Machine Learning, in simple terms, is a subset of AI that focuses on the development of algorithms and models that enable computers to learn from and make predictions or decisions without being explicitly programmed. It involves the use of statistical techniques to empower machines to improve their performance on a specific task through experience.
There are three main types of Machine Learning algorithms:
- Supervised Learning: This type of algorithm learns from labeled data, where the input and output are provided. It uses this labeled data to predict future outputs based on new inputs.
- Unsupervised Learning: In contrast to supervised learning, unsupervised learning algorithms work with unlabeled data. They aim to discover patterns, relationships, and structures within the data without any predefined output.
- Reinforcement Learning: Reinforcement learning algorithms learn through interactions with the environment. They receive feedback in the form of rewards or punishments based on their actions and use this feedback to improve their decision-making abilities.
Types of Machine Learning Algorithms
Within these broader categories, there are various specific algorithms that cater to different types of problems. Some popular machine learning algorithms include:
- Decision Trees: Decision trees are a graphical representation of decision-making processes. They use a hierarchical structure of nodes and branches to classify data based on a series of questions or conditions.
- Random Forests: Random forests are an ensemble learning method that combines multiple decision trees to make predictions. Each tree is trained on a different subset of the data, and the final prediction is based on the votes of all the individual trees.
- Support Vector Machines: Support Vector Machines (SVM) are powerful algorithms used for classification and regression tasks. They create a hyperplane that separates data into different classes, maximizing the margin between the classes.
It is important to note that these are just a few examples of the wide range of machine learning algorithms available. Each algorithm has its own strengths and weaknesses, and the choice of algorithm depends on the specific problem and the type of data available.
Applications of Machine Learning
Machine Learning has found applications in various fields and industries, revolutionizing the way we live, work, and interact with technology. Some notable applications of ML include:
- Healthcare: ML algorithms have been used to develop predictive models for diagnosing diseases, detecting anomalies in medical images, and personalizing treatment plans based on patient data.
- Finance: Machine Learning is extensively used in the finance industry for fraud detection, risk assessment, algorithmic trading, and credit scoring.
- Recommendation Systems: Online platforms like Amazon and Netflix use ML algorithms to provide personalized recommendations to users based on their browsing and purchase history.
- Natural Language Processing: ML plays a crucial role in Natural Language Processing tasks such as sentiment analysis, language translation, and speech recognition.
These are just a few examples of how Machine Learning is transforming various sectors. Its potential is vast, and we are only scratching the surface of what it can achieve.
What is Artificial Intelligence?
While Machine Learning is a subset of Artificial Intelligence, AI encompasses a broader range of capabilities. Artificial Intelligence refers to the development of systems or machines that can perform tasks that typically require human intelligence, such as perception, reasoning, learning, and problem-solving.
AI can be classified into two main categories:
- Narrow AI: Also known as Weak AI, Narrow AI refers to AI systems that are designed to perform specific tasks efficiently. These systems excel in their specialized domain but lack the ability to generalize beyond their specific area of expertise.
- General AI: General AI, also known as Strong AI or Artificial General Intelligence (AGI), refers to AI systems that possess the ability to understand, learn, and apply knowledge across a wide range of tasks and domains. General AI aims to replicate human-level intelligence and is a subject of ongoing research and development.
Difference between Machine Learning and Artificial Intelligence
The main difference between Machine Learning and Artificial Intelligence lies in their scope and focus. Machine Learning is concerned with the development of algorithms that enable computers to learn and make predictions based on data, while Artificial Intelligence encompasses a broader range of capabilities that mimic human intelligence.
Machine Learning can be seen as a subset of AI, as it focuses on training algorithms to make predictions or decisions without being explicitly programmed. On the other hand, AI encompasses not only the ability to learn from data but also the ability to reason, perceive, and solve problems.
Applications of Artificial Intelligence
Artificial Intelligence has found applications in a wide range of industries and domains. Some prominent applications of AI include:
- Autonomous Vehicles: AI is at the core of self-driving cars, enabling them to perceive their environment, make decisions, and navigate safely.
- Robotics: AI is used in robotics to enable machines to perform complex tasks, such as assembly line operations, surgical procedures, and hazardous material handling.
- Virtual Assistants: Popular virtual assistants like Siri, Alexa, and Google Assistant utilize AI algorithms to understand and respond to user queries and commands.
- Image and Speech Recognition: AI algorithms power facial recognition systems, voice assistants, and image classification applications.
As AI continues to advance, its applications are expanding into more areas, promising to revolutionize industries and enhance our daily lives.
The Future of Machine Learning and Artificial Intelligence
The future of Machine Learning and Artificial Intelligence is brimming with possibilities. As technology continues to advance, we can expect ML AI to play an even more significant role in shaping our lives and society.
Advancements in ML AI are anticipated in various areas, including:
- Deep Learning: Deep Learning, a subfield of ML AI, focuses on neural networks with multiple layers. Continued advancements in deep learning techniques are expected to unlock new possibilities in image and speech recognition, natural language processing, and other domains.
- Data Privacy and Ethics: As ML AI becomes more prevalent, concerns about data privacy and ethics are gaining attention. The future will see increased efforts to develop robust frameworks and regulations to ensure the ethical use of ML AI and protect individuals’ privacy.
- AI Augmentation: AI augmentation refers to the use of AI to enhance human capabilities, rather than replacing them. This concept will continue to gain momentum, with AI systems acting as intelligent assistants that complement human decision-making and problem-solving.
With each passing day, we are moving closer to a future where ML AI will become an integral part of our lives, driving innovation, efficiency, and new possibilities.
Ethical Considerations in Machine Learning and Artificial Intelligence
As ML AI continues to advance, it is crucial to address the ethical considerations that arise with the use of these technologies. The potential impact of ML AI on society, privacy, and human decision-making necessitates careful consideration and responsible development.
Some key ethical considerations in ML AI include:
- Bias and Fairness: ML AI systems are trained on historical data, which may contain biases. It is essential to ensure that these biases are not perpetuated in the algorithms, leading to unfair outcomes or discrimination.
- Transparency and Explainability: ML AI models often work as black boxes, making it challenging to understand the reasoning behind their decisions. Ensuring transparency and explainability in ML AI systems is crucial for building trust and addressing accountability.
- Data Privacy and Security: ML AI relies on vast amounts of data, raising concerns about privacy and security. Organizations must handle data responsibly, ensuring proper consent, anonymization, and protection against data breaches.
- Job Displacement: The widespread adoption of ML AI technologies may lead to job displacement in certain industries. It is important to consider the social and economic implications of these changes and develop strategies to mitigate negative impacts.
Addressing these ethical considerations requires collaboration between policymakers, researchers, and industry experts. By prioritizing ethics and responsible development, we can harness the full potential of ML AI while minimizing the potential risks.
In conclusion, Machine Learning and Artificial Intelligence are rapidly evolving fields that hold tremendous potential to transform our world. Machine Learning focuses on developing algorithms that enable computers to learn and make predictions based on data, while Artificial Intelligence encompasses broader capabilities that mimic human intelligence.
The applications of ML AI span across various industries, revolutionizing healthcare, finance, recommendation systems, and natural language processing, among others. As ML AI continues to advance, the future holds even more exciting possibilities, including deep learning, AI augmentation, and advancements in data privacy and ethics.
However, it is crucial to address the ethical considerations that arise with the use of ML AI. Bias, transparency, data privacy, and job displacement are just a few of the ethical considerations that require careful attention and responsible development.
As we navigate the world of ML AI, it is essential to strike a balance between innovation and responsibility. By doing so, we can unlock the full potential of ML AI while ensuring a future that is both technologically advanced and ethically sound.